Mishawaka Farmers Market moving to a new location

Photo: Facebook/ Mishawaka Farmers Market

MISHAWAKA, Ind.—The Mishawaka Farmers Market is moving to a new location.

Starting Sunday, July 5, the market will set up shop at 230 Ironworks Avenue.

The farmers market will continue to be open every Sunday until September 27 from 11 a.m. to 3 p.m.

The market previously used Central Park.

A variety of vendors sell goods at the farmers market including fruits, vegetables, baked goods, home goods, dog items and more.
